عَمَاءَةٌ

1.
, (K, TA,) or عَمَاءٌ, (CK, and so in my MS. copy of the K,) and عَمَايَةٌ, and عَمِيَّةٌ, and عُمِيَّةٌ, (assumed tropical:) Error: and (assumed tropical:) persistence; or con- tention, or litigation, or wrangling; or persistence in contention or litigation or wrangling; synonym لَجَاجٌ; (K, TA;) in that which is false or vain or futile: (TA:) [or the last but one, or the last, signifies (assumed tropical:) ignorance; for] فِيهِمْ عَمِيَّتُهُمْ or عُمِيَّتُهُمْ (according to different copies of the S) means In them is their ignorance. (S.) [See also عِمِّيَّةٌ, and عِمِّيَّا.]
